Output f12bb641cec23e02697692892afcc98f38162e72d765c51f9f3f8ad0cb5317f8:0

value
43397799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0003747120677c1942189e3a341bfe3a378ade5 OP_EQUAL
address
MSry3LKPcS7tBpUWwuyeFqQAzJgEbsRGnr
transaction
f12bb641cec23e02697692892afcc98f38162e72d765c51f9f3f8ad0cb5317f8
spent
true